Standing Cypress

8_16_16

The cypress trees are magical trees. I have never seen any trees grow in water before I came to SC. It is amazing to see so many cypress standing in swamp. It is actually very odd experience for me to walk through the passageway in the cypress garden. There are many white Herons, turtles, and alligators. I feel like I were in the primitive age.
